The 2017 National Conservation Innovation Grants (CIG) APF opportunity, offered by the USDA Natural Resources Conservation Service (NRCS), is a discretionary grant program designed to speed up the development and real-world adoption of innovative conservation methods and technologies that also support agricultural production. The central goal is not basic research for its own sake, but practical innovation that can be demonstrated in working landscapes and then scaled. Projects are expected to produce results that can be transferred and used broadly, such as moving proven conservation technologies and management systems into the hands of EQIP-eligible producers (the Environmental Quality Incentives Program audience), being incorporated into NRCS technical manuals and guides, or being adopted by the private sector. A major emphasis is placed on applying or demonstrating approaches that already have evidence behind them, using CIG funding to expand adoption and test implementation at farm or field scale, especially where there is a clear path to scaling an emerging but proven strategy.
The program strongly encourages on-the-ground conservation innovation, including pilot projects, field demonstrations, and on-farm conservation research. In this context, on-farm conservation research has a specific meaning: it must be designed to answer a defined conservation question using a statistically valid approach, carried out on actual farm fields with farm-scale equipment, and supported by adequate replication and statistical analysis. NRCS indicates that when it funds research through CIG, it will prioritize on-farm research that clearly stimulates innovative approaches to natural resource management in conjunction with agricultural production, reinforcing the program focus on implementable solutions rather than purely academic inquiry. CIG also highlights collaboration and knowledge-sharing, aiming to spread skills, technology, and access to facilities across communities, governments, and institutions so that conservation advances are usable by more people, not confined to a single organization or location.
Applications could be submitted for single-year or multi-year projects, with a maximum project period of up to three years. The geographic scope is broad: proposals were accepted from eligible entities in any of the 50 states, the District of Columbia, the Caribbean Area (Puerto Rico and the U.S. Virgin Islands), and the Pacific Islands Area (Guam, American Samoa, and the Commonwealth of the Northern Mariana Islands). Eligibility is similarly wide and includes Indian Tribes, state and local governmental units, nonprofit organizations (including 501(c)(3) organizations), public and private institutions of higher education, individuals, and for-profit entities (including small businesses). The program is categorized under agriculture, environment, and natural resources, and is associated with CFDA number 10.912.
The funding opportunity (USDA NRCS NHQ CIG 17 01) was posted on November 3, 2016, and had an original application deadline of January 9, 2017. The maximum award amount listed was up to $2,000,000, and NRCS anticipated making about 60 awards. Proposals submitted by the deadline were reviewed through a two-tier selection process. First, a technical peer review panel evaluated complete proposals against the published proposal evaluation criteria. Then, full proposals, along with input from both the technical peer review panel and the State Conservationist, were forwarded to the NRCS Grants Review Board. The Grants Review Board made recommendations to the NRCS Chief, who made the final funding selections.
